WebFor an ISO standard headset with a 30.2mm frame cup outside diameter, the head tube inner diameter is 30.1 mm, to achieve a press fit, so the code is EC30 For a Japan Industrial Standard (J.I.S.) headset with a 30.0mm frame cup outside diameter, the head tube inner diameter is 29.9mm and so the code is EC29. Web13 jul. 2024 · Matching the Size and Common Headset Bearing Types The trick for measuring the outside angle (most of which are 45º) requires you to have a spare … Web2nd step: the outside diameter of the bearing. A / Put your bearing on the grid as shown in the diagram. B / Mark the outline of the outer ring. For more convenience, use a pencil with a fine point. C / For ease of reading, do not hesitate to draw lines to the axes and then take the measurement. WebIf you measured at 9.5mm its probably an inch sized bearing. To measure the bore of a bearing you can use a vernier caliper like the one shown. Insert the outer anvils of the caliper into the bore as shown and open the caliper until the bearing and caliper are a good fit about each other. Now read the value on the caliper.

Web16 sep. 2016 · Just measure the diameter, will be either 1/4" or 3/16", usually (like 95% of the time) the latter. The cage has no effect on diameter, you just buy more.
